# Friend.Tech Devs Abandon Once-Hot SocialFi Platform *Author: David Christopher* *Published: Sep 9, 2024* *Source: https://www.bankless.com/friend-tech-dead* --- On Sunday, Friend.Tech’s developers gave up control of the platform's smart contracts, blocking future updates, and essentially closing down. ## What's the scoop? - **Initial Success:** Launched on Base in August 2023, Friend.Tech quickly surpassed Ethereum in daily earnings by mid-September and secured an undisclosed amount of funding from Paradigm. - **Decline in Activity:** The protocol [struggled after its initial success](https://www.theblock.co/post/315172/friend-tech-team-renounces-control-of-smart-contracts-following-stagnant-growth), and despite the Version 2 update and airdrop, protocol fees stalled, with only $60K earned since June. - **Locked System:** The contract revocation prevents new teams from taking over, signaling an unlikely revival for the platform. ## Bankless Take:  Friend.Tech's rise and fall reflect the difficulty of discovering the proper implementations of the long-sought-after “SocialFi.” While at first it captured significant attention, the platform couldn’t restore its momentum with V2, which came with a lackluster airdrop and a fraction of the [features initially teased](https://www.bankless.com/socialfi-friendtech-v2). The future of Friend.Tech felt grim when the team announced they would build [FriendChain, its own L2](https://www.bankless.com/friend-tech-plans-to-launch-friendchain), but now, with the developers renouncing control, stopping anyone else from taking over the project, *any* path forward seems essentially nonexistent.
